Romain Navarrete to leave Catalans


 
 

Catalans Dragons can confirm Romain Navarrete will leave the club at the end of the season.

The Catalan Prop will join Wigan Warriors next season on a two-year deal.

Romain Navarrete said: “I would like to thank the club for giving me the opportunity to play in the Super League. My wish was to stay here but I have always dreamt to play for Wigan and I couldn’t refuse this opportunity.”

Navarrete has made 11 appearances since making his Super League debut against Huddersfield in May.

Club CEO Christophe Jouffret said: “It’s always disappointing to lose a homegrown player but, as other French players, Romain will have a great experience in UK that will enrich its potential for the benefit of the National Team and I’m sure he will come back home stronger. We would like to wish him all the best for his new Challenge at Wigan.”
